I don't really like the word fasting, or just thinking of fasting as something special - fasting is the norm for good health. The human body was engineered to eat large meals, and then go for longer periods without food - a hunt.

In an environment of abundance and opulence, it's easy to become detached from your nature by saturating your body with sugar nonstop. This is the typical root cause of metabolic dysfunction, along with consumption of alcohol

By learning to be stoic (to be at ease) with being hungry, you're in full control of your health

Ancient in this context refers to ~2 billion years ago, before the Great Oxidation Event. Basically before the atmosphere had oxygen in it, and anaerobic energy production was the only option

Cells and microbes still possess the ability to do this in an anaerobic environment, which is prevalent in fat people who are huffing and wheezing just struggling to take in enough oxygen for their overabundance of cells
